Self-oscillation perturbations in a fast-flow unstable resonator laser

A. I. Odintsov, N. E. Sarkarov, A. I. Fedoseev

Lomonosov Moscow State University, Faculty of Physics

Abstract: It is shown with the help of numerical simulation that various mechanisms of self-oscillation instability exist and self-oscillation perturbations of various types may appear in an unstable resonator with a transverse flow of the active medium and a nonuniform internal pumping. The interaction of different self-oscillation perturbations, manifested in pulling and locking of oscillation frequencies and a variation of their increments, is studied. Analytic relations describing the spatial structure of perturbation modes and used for evaluating their frequencies and increments from steady-state generation parameters are presented.
